Philips Wouwerman (1619-1668)
A Stable with Travellers resting their Mounts
signed with monogram and initial 'PHLS W'; with inventory number 506
on panel
11 5/8 x 15in. (29.5 x 38cm.)

Provenance
The Barons van der Houven (seal on the reverse)
Dresden, Royal Picture Gallery, for which acquired in Antwerp in 1710
(inventory of 1722, no.A506; catalogue of 1905, no.1460); sold in 1924 to Haus Wettin
Anon. Sale, Fischer, Lucerne, 17 June 1977, lot 396 (S.Fr.105,000)
Anon. Sale, Sotheby's, 9 April 1986, lot 139

Literature
C. Hofstede de Groot, A Catalogue Raisonné, etc., II, 1909, p.397, no.485
